CLAVOS APRIL MILL RUN UPDATE

Sage Gold Inc. has completed its latest bulk sample mill run. The custom mill processed 6,252 dry tonnes of mineralized material yielding approximately 513 ounces of gold.

The mineralized material in the April mill run was sourced from the 150 West, 150 East, 175 East and 200-metre levels.More specifically, the milled material comprised Clavos broken stope material from 150 West, previously mined material from 150 East, development material from the 175 Footwall East drive, and remnant material sourced from the 175E-480 and 200-493 long hole stopes, previously developed by St. Andrew Goldfields, the previous operator.

Nigel Lees, president and chief executive officer, commented: "We are pleased to see an improving trend in grade and tonnage as we are starting to mine higher-grade material above and including the 200-metre level."

The operational plans disclosed in this news release have been reviewed and approved by Sage Gold's consulting mining engineer, Robert Ritchie, PEng, who is a qualified person as defined in National Instrument 43-101.

The company plans to complete a mineral resource and mineral reserve estimate and a prefeasibility study regarding the Clavos project.In the event that a production decision is made that is not based on a prefeasibility study of mineral reserves demonstrating economic and technical viability prepared in accordance with National Instrument 43-101, readers are cautioned that there is increased uncertainty and higher risk of economic and technical failure associated with such production decisions.

About Sage Gold Inc.

The company is a mineral exploration and development company which has primary interests in near-term production and exploration properties in Ontario.Its main properties are the Clavos gold property, 100 per cent owned, in Timmins, and the 100-per-cent-owned Onaman property and other exploration properties in the Beardmore-Geraldton gold camp.Technical reports and information relating to the properties can be obtained from SEDAR and from the company's website.
